ฟื้นฟูเว็บยุคใหม่บน ZX Spectrum: ชุมชนสำรวจการท่องเว็บในระบบ 8-Bit

ทีมชุมชน BigGo
ฟื้นฟูเว็บยุคใหม่บน ZX Spectrum: ชุมชนสำรวจการท่องเว็บในระบบ 8-Bit

ในโลกของคอมพิวเตอร์วินเทจ ผู้ที่หลงใหลมักจะผลักดันขีดจำกัดของสิ่งที่ทำได้ด้วยฮาร์ดแวร์เก่าแก่ โครงการล่าสุดที่จินตนาการเว็บไซต์ยุคใหม่อย่าง Google และ Hacker News ใหม่ให้เหมาะกับคอมพิวเตอร์ ZX Spectrum จากยุค 1980 ได้จุดประกายการอภิปรายอย่างคึกคักในชุมชนเทคโนโลยี แม้การสาธิตเดิมจะใช้การจำลองระบบ (emulation) แต่ผู้แสดงความคิดเห็นเปิดเผยว่าการเชื่อมต่ออินเทอร์เน็ตจริงบนเครื่อง 8-Bit คลาสสิกนั้นมีความเป็นไปได้มากกว่าที่คิด

ความเป็นจริงของฮาร์ดแวร์กับการท่องเว็บ 8-Bit

การอภิปรายในชุมชนเปิดเผยว่าการเข้าถึงอินเทอร์เน็ตยุคปัจจุบันบน ZX Spectrum ไม่ใช่แค่เรื่องทฤษฎี ผู้แสดงความคิดเห็นหลายคนชี้ไปที่โซลูชันฮาร์ดแวร์ที่มีอยู่ซึ่งทำให้การเชื่อมต่อเว็บจริงเป็นไปได้ อินเทอร์เฟซ Spectranet ถูกกล่าวถึงโดยเฉพาะในฐานะอุปกรณ์ที่เปิดใช้งานการเชื่อมต่อเครือข่าย TCP/IP บนคอมพิวเตอร์วินเทจ โดยจัดการงานเครือข่ายที่ซับซ้อนซึ่งอาจจะเกินกำลังของโปรเซสเซอร์ Z80

นอกจากนี้ยังมี Spectranet และโคลนสำหรับ Sinclair Spectrum ซึ่งช่วยให้มีประสบการณ์ที่เชื่อมต่อกับอินเทอร์เน็ตที่หลากหลายมากขึ้น มันสามารถโหลดและบูตโปรแกรมระยะไกลจากเซิร์ฟเวอร์ซึ่งช่วยให้คุณสร้างสรรค์ได้ค่อนข้างมาก

โซลูชันฮาร์ดแวร์นี้แสดงให้เห็นว่าช่องว่างระหว่างการจำลองของโครงการเดิมและการนำไปใช้จริงอาจจะเล็กกว่าที่คาด Spectranet ทำหน้าที่เป็นโค-โปรเซสเซอร์ โดยรับภาระหนักของโปรโตคอล TCP/IP ออกจากทรัพยากรที่จำกัดของ Spectrum

ตัวเลือกการเชื่อมต่อสมัยใหม่สำหรับ ZX Spectrum:

  • อินเทอร์เฟซ Spectranet: ความสามารถในการถ่ายโอน TCP/IP
  • PPP TCP/IP stack: โซลูชันเครือข่ายแบบซอฟต์แวร์
  • Gopher clients: การเข้าถึงอินเทอร์เน็ตแบบข้อความ
  • Telnet clients: การเชื่อมต่อ BBS และเทอร์มินัล
  • Web bridges: แปลงเว็บไซต์สมัยใหม่ให้อยู่ในรูปแบบที่เข้าถึงได้

ทางเลือกแบบข้อความสำหรับระบบที่มีข้อจำกัด

ผู้แสดงความคิดเห็นหลายคนแนะนำว่าโปรโตคอลแบบข้อความ เช่น Gopher ให้แนวทางที่ใช้งานได้จริงมากกว่าสำหรับการเข้าถึงอินเทอร์เน็ตบนระบบที่มีข้อจำกัดสูง เซิร์ฟเวอร์ Gopher ที่ยังใช้งานอยู่หลายแห่งถูกแชร์ในการอภิปราย รวมถึง magical.fish สำหรับฟีดข่าว, bitreich.org ในฐานะบริการไดเรกทอรีที่ช่วยย้อนระลึกถึงพอร์ทัลเว็บยุคแรกเริ่ม และแม้แต่กระจกเงา (mirror) ของ Hacker News ที่ hngopher.com บริการที่เน้นข้อความเหล่านี้สอดคล้องอย่างสมบูรณ์แบบกับจุดแข็งของ ZX Spectrum ในขณะที่หลีกเลี่ยงความซับซ้อนของการแสดงผลเว็บสมัยใหม่

การสนทนายังกล่าวถึงโซลูชันการแสดงผลที่สร้างสรรค์เพื่อเอาชนะข้อจำกัด 32 ตัวอักษรต่อบรรทัดของ Spectrum ผู้แสดงความคิด็น recalled ซอฟต์แวร์เฉพาะทางอย่าง Tasword 2 ที่ใช้ฟอนต์ขนาดเล็กมากเพื่อแสดงข้อความในแนวนอนได้มากขึ้น บางคนกล่าวถึงเทคนิคการพิมพ์ 64 คอลัมน์ และฟอนต์กำหนดเองเช่น Vaticanus ที่อาจจะแสดงได้ 64 ตัวอักษรต่อบรรทัด ซึ่งเป็นการปรับปรุงความสามารถในการแสดงข้อความของเครื่องสำหรับเนื้อหาเว็บได้อย่างมาก

แหล่งข้อมูล Gopher ที่ยังใช้งานอยู่ที่กล่าวถึง:

  • gopher://hngopher.com (เว็บมิเรอร์ของ Hacker News)
  • gopher://magical.fish (ฟีดข่าวและบริการต่างๆ)
  • gopher://bitreich.org (บริการไดเรกทอรี)
  • gopher://sdf.org (บล็อกและชุมชน)
  • gopher://gutenberg.icu (เข้าถึง Project Gutenberg)

ความท้าทายทางเทคนิคและโซลูชันที่สร้างสรรค์

ชุมชนระบุถึงอุปสรรคทางเทคนิคหลายประการที่ทำให้การท่องเว็บสมัยใหม่มีความท้าทายเป็นพิเศษบนระบบ 8-Bit ผู้แสดงความคิดเห็นหนึ่งคนระบุว่า Google เพิ่งยกเลิกอินเทอร์เฟซการค้นหาแบบ HTTP อย่างง่ายซึ่งก่อนหน้านี้ทำงานร่วมกับคำขอ GET แบบตรงไปตรงมายังพอร์ต 80 การเปลี่ยนไปใช้ HTTPS ที่บังคับและข้อกำหนด JavaScript ได้ปิดกั้นระบบที่ไม่มีขีดความสามารถการเข้ารหัสสมัยใหม่อย่างมีประสิทธิภาพ

แม้จะมีอุปสรรคเหล่านี้ การอภิปรายก็เปิดเผยทางเลี่ยงและทางเลือกหลายทาง ไคลเอนต์ Telnet อนุญาตให้เข้าถึงระบบ BBS แบบดั้งเดิม ในขณะที่สะพาน (bridges) พิเศษสามารถแยกวิเคราะห์เว็บไซต์และแปลงเป็นรูปแบบที่เข้าถึงได้มากขึ้น ธีมพื้นฐานตลอดทั้งความคิดเห็นคือการแก้ปัญหาอย่างสร้างสรรค์ — การหาวิธีทำให้บริการอินเทอร์เน็ตร่วมสมัยสามารถเข้าถึงได้ผ่านเลนส์ของข้อจำกัดในการคำนวณยุค 1980

โครงการและการอภิปรายตามมาช่วยเน้นย้ำความหลงใหลที่ต่อเนื่องกับการผลักดันฮาร์ดแวร์วินเทจให้เกินกว่าจุดประสงค์เดิมที่ตั้งใจไว้ สิ่งที่เริ่มต้นเป็นการฝึกออกแบบอินเทอร์เฟซเชิงแนวความคิดสำหรับระบบที่มีข้อจำกัดสูง ได้พัฒนากลายเป็นการสำรวจเชิงปฏิบัติว่าสิ่งที่ทำได้จริงคืออะไรด้วยการรวมกันที่เหมาะสมของอินเทอร์เฟซฮาร์ดแวร์ โปรโตคอลทางเลือก และความรู้ของชุมชน

เสน่ห์ที่ยั่งยืนของโครงการเหล่านี้อยู่ที่การแสดงให้เห็นว่าแม้แต่ระบบที่มีข้อจำกัดมากที่สุดก็สามารถมีส่วนร่วมในโลกที่เชื่อมต่อของเราได้ด้วยแนวทางที่เหมาะสม ตามที่ผู้แสดงความคิดเห็นหนึ่งคนสรุปความรู้สึกได้อย่างสมบูรณ์แบบ: น่าทึ่งมากที่ได้เข้าถึงอินเทอร์เน็ตยุคใหม่บนเครื่อง 8-Bit จากต้นยุค 80 ที่เดิมทีโหลดเกมจากตลับเทป การผสมผสานระหว่างความนóstalgia และความคิดสร้างสรรค์ทางเทคนิคนี้ยังคงขับเคลื่อนนวัตกรรมในชุมชนคอมพิวเตอร์วินเทจ พิสูจน์ให้เห็นว่าบางครั้งข้อจำกัดก็ก่อให้เกิดโซลูชันที่น่าสนใจที่สุด

อ้างอิง: Old Computer Challenge - Modern web for the ZX Spectrum